In the Pro version, just add Network Shared Calendar and point the URL to something like
https://mailserver.my.domain/home/us...lendar?fmt=ics.
There no need to import and export. Rainlendar2 pull the ical directly from server.
I also recommend turning on "read only" flag, even though rainlendar2 can put events back into the calendar, it may overwirte changes/exceptions in the reoccurring meetings when you are update/adding other meetings to Rainlendar. Work best just for monitoring and notification.
